ToggleTypes of business licenses in Dubai
Dubai is considered a vital business and economic center in the Middle East, and is characterized by an encouraging business environment that attracts investors from all over the world. Commercial licenses in Dubai vary to suit different types of economic activities. Business licenses in Dubai can be divided into three main types:
Commercial license
A commercial license is a license granted to companies engaged in traditional commercial activities such as buying, selling, distribution, importing and exporting. This license includes all types of trade, from selling consumer products to electronic goods, clothing, etc. This license is considered the most common among foreign and local investors due to the diversity of activities it includes and the ease of obtaining it.
Professional license
The professional license is granted to individuals or companies that provide specialized professional and consulting services. This license includes activities that require specific skills and experience, such as legal services, accounting, auditing, engineering, medicine, and education. This license is very suitable for professionals who want to provide their services independently or through their own companies.
Industrial license
The industrial license is intended for companies that wish to establish industrial activities including manufacturing, production and assembly. This license requires a high level of investment in infrastructure and equipment. This license is necessary for companies aiming to set up factories or production units in Dubai. Industrial activities include the manufacture of food, chemical products, electronic equipment, plastics, and others.

How to obtain a business license in Dubai
Obtaining a business license in Dubai is a vital step for any investor or entrepreneur who wishes to establish his business in the emirate. This process includes a set of procedures and requirements that applicants must adhere to to ensure obtaining the license legally and effectively. The following is an explanation of how to obtain a commercial license in Dubai:
- Choosing a business activity: The investor must determine the type of business activity he wishes to practice, as the type of activity required varies based on the specific license (commercial, professional, industrial).
- Determine the legal form of the company: The investor must choose the legal form of the company such as a limited liability company (LLC), a sole proprietorship, a joint liability company, and others.
- Trade name: Choose an appropriate trade name for the company that complies with the laws in force in Dubai, and the name must not be used by another company.
- Approval of relevant authorities: In some cases, the investor may need to obtain additional approvals from specific government authorities, depending on the type of business activity.
Steps to obtain a commercial license in Dubai
After meeting the basic requirements, the investor can begin the application process for obtaining a commercial license by following the following steps:
- Submitting a license application: The application for a commercial license is submitted through the website of the Department of Economic Development in Dubai, or by visiting one of the approved service centers.
- Submitting the required documents: A set of supporting documents must be submitted, such as a copy of the passport, a personal photo, a copy of the lease contract for the company’s headquarters, and any other documents requested by the concerned authorities.
- Application review: The competent authorities review the application and submitted documents to ensure that all conditions and requirements are met.
- Obtaining approvals: If the business requires additional approvals, coordination will be made with the relevant authorities to obtain these approvals.
- Issuance of the license: After completing all procedures and approvals, the commercial license is issued and delivered to the investor.
Business license costs in Dubai
The fees and costs associated with obtaining a business license in Dubai vary based on the type of business activity and the legal form of the company. Fees usually include:
- Application submission fees: These are fees paid when submitting an application to obtain a license.
- Approvals fees: In some cases, there may be additional fees for obtaining approvals from relevant authorities.
- License fees: These are the annual fees paid to obtain and renew a commercial license.
- Other costs: Additional costs may include such as rental fees, and other government service fees.

Tax facilities
Dubai is characterized by a flexible tax system that is attractive to investors, as the Dubai government does not impose taxes on personal income or corporate profits in most sectors. This allows companies to achieve greater profits and use these profits to expand and develop their business. Dubai also provides double tax agreements with many countries, which contributes to reducing tax burdens on foreign investors.
Advanced infrastructure
Dubai offers advanced infrastructure that includes fast communications networks, modern roads and transportation, and world-class ports and airports. This advanced infrastructure facilitates transportation and shipping operations and moves employees and goods quickly and efficiently, reducing operational costs and increasing business effectiveness.

Frequently asked questions about the commercial license in Dubai
Does the commercial license include residence visas?
Yes, obtaining a trade license can help in obtaining residence visas for the owner, partners and employees based on the trade license.
Is it possible to change the business activity after obtaining the license?
Yes, it is possible to change the business activity after obtaining the commercial license. This requires submitting a request to modify the activity and obtaining the necessary approvals from the competent authorities.
How can I renew the commercial license?
The commercial license can be renewed by submitting a renewal application and paying the prescribed fees. Required documents must be submitted, such as a certified lease contract and financial reports if necessary.
Can a trade license be transferred from a free zone to main Dubai?
Yes, a business license can be transferred from a free zone to main Dubai, but this requires canceling the previous license and obtaining a new license from the Department of Economic Development (DED).
Do all businesses need special approvals?
Some commercial activities require special approvals from certain government agencies. For example, health activities require approvals from the Dubai Health Authority, and tourism activities require approvals from the Department of Tourism and Commerce Marketing.
